Thursday, November 21, 2024
Wheels & Deals

New York Auto Show 2009

  SMS Supercars
SMS Supercars
Click to enlarge

Auto Show Photo Galleries:

Models of SMS Supercars
image
570 Challenger ( 7 Photos )